ENG
SA
null
Zimbabwe
Sri Lanka
Bangladesh
Netherlands
AFG
PAK
NAM
CAN
Surrey
Northamptonshire
Trinbago Knight Riders
St Lucia Kings
Thunder won by 7 wickets (with 30 balls remaining)
Olivia Bell conjures dream spell as Diamonds all but vanish from Finals Day race